Prowlin....the window decals are easy...have already made and installed mine....just get clear decal sheets for your printer at Staples or what ever office supply store is in your area....you must reverse the picture, resize it and print it backwards...then when you install it on the inside of the glass it is the right direction....very simple, even if my explanation is not....

Laddie yes buy T-Shirt transfer paper for your laser jet if you have some old T-Shits you may want to do some practice. Before printing on the Transfer Paper you have to reverse the image. I have also found sometime it works better if you brighten the image before you print it as well. I think it depend on the brand of transfer paper. Anyone whom has experimented what Brand of Transfer have you found to be the best?
